Chain Bridge to Display Polish, Hungarian National Colors

Budapest's Chain Bridge will display Polish and Hungarian national colors on Polish-Hungarian Friendship Day, according to an announcement from Sándor Palace, the office of the Hungarian President of the Republic.

On March 23, the countries' respective flags will line the bridge "in commemoration of the centuries-old friendship and alliance between Hungary and Poland" in accordance with a decision of President of the Republic, Tamás Sulyok, the statement said.

Common respect for tradition in the Hungarian and Polish peoples, the desire for freedom and Christian values and intertwined history were at the heart of the two countries' friendship, it added.

In 2007, Hungary's and Poland's parliaments declared March 23 a holiday of friendly relations between the two peoples, and commemorations are held alternately in a city in each of the two countries every year.

This year, Tamás Sulyok will participate in the festive event of the Polish-Hungarian Friendship Day in Przemysl together with the Polish President Karol Nawrocki, the statement noted.
